Output e3325a25ce1769c3612144e75730b9df356008448487a4294305ad10c589822b:79

value
1907151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1958f061718a114ff490c4a1e4fa37201fa661eb OP_EQUAL
address
3413MvpFt22uFsaFhGQ1nQsLkQudR8N2Aq
transaction
e3325a25ce1769c3612144e75730b9df356008448487a4294305ad10c589822b
spent
true